100 days ago I decided to go on one of my crazy kicks where I try to blog at least once every day1. Previous attempts faltered at 88, 58 and a very, very pathetic 25 days, but this time I’ve somehow been able to keep at it and here I am, blogging my 100th day in a row.

Now, some people have asked me, “Why do you want to blog every single day?” or “Are you insane?” or “What’s a blog?” But the thing is: I like blogging. There are so many interesting (and hilarious and infuriating) things I encounter every day, I just *have* to share them. And what’s a girl to do when there’s no one around to hear her various witty remarks?2

In the last 100 days, I’ve blogged about everything from America (see: Bank of) to Zombies (see: Gay). I’ve been to a blogging conference and been featured as a geek girl blogger on Spyjournal. I’ve taught y’all about 10 Canadian Prime Ministers and started my new series on BC Premiers. Wow, scrolling through my postings to write this paragraph, I’ve just discovered that I blogged about Socrates TWICE3! Hell, I live blogged my laser eye surgery! But I think my favourite posting in these last 100 days was the handwritten one.

Here’s to another 100 days of blogging!
